stock pictures are professionally captured images that are available for licensing and use by individuals, businesses, and organizations. They are produced by photographers and made available through stock photography websites. These websites offer a wide range of high-quality images, covering various themes, concepts, and subjects.

Frequently Asked Questions:
1. Can I use stock photos for commercial purposes?
Yes, stock photos can be used for commercial purposes. However, it is important to ensure that you have the appropriate license or permission to use the images in accordance with the terms and conditions of the stock photography website.
2. How can I find stock photos that match my brand's aesthetic?
Most stock photography websites provide search filters that allow you to narrow down your options based on factors such as color, style, and composition. By utilizing these filters and conducting thorough searches, you can find stock photos that align with your brand's aesthetic.
3. Are there any free stock photo options available?
Yes, there are several stock photography websites that offer a selection of free stock photos. However, it's essential to carefully read and understand the licensing terms for these images to ensure compliance with any usage restrictions.
4. How can I avoid using stock photos that are overused or generic?
To avoid using stock photos that are overused or generic, take the time to dig deeper into the search results and explore less popular images or lesser-known photographers. Additionally, consider investing in premium stock photo options that offer exclusive or niche collections.
5. Can I edit or modify stock photos to better fit my needs?
Yes, you can edit or modify stock photos to better fit your specific needs. However, be sure to review the usage rights associated with the images to ensure that any modifications you make are within the permitted scope of usage.
